Let’s get this straight.  The Left shrugged at Obama’s twenty years of alliance with a minister who spouted an infamous “God Damn America”.  They sniffed when Jeremiah Wright called 9/11 “America’s chickens coming home to roost”.  They may have even nodded their heads in agreement when the pastor to whom Obama gave over $20,000 in 2006 accused the US government of creating the HIV virus and AIDS as a genocidal tool against people of color.

However, Rick Warren offers public support for a California proposition that keeps marriage defined as his faith prescribes, and suddenly Obama has betrayed their trust.  Really?  They see a one-time association over a 60-second invocation as a betrayal of their values, when Obama’s twenty years with, and significant material support for, a raving anti-American demagogue like Wright didn’t disturb them in the least?

At least we know where their values lie.
